Join the St. Louis Kaplan Feldman Holocaust Museum and the Jewish Federation of St. Louis, for a meaningful day of remembrance, reflection, and community as we come together to commemorate October 7.
The Museum is also continuing its important work to preserve the stories and experiences connected to October 7, 2023. As part of this ongoing call for collections, community members are invited to contribute objects, photographs, documents, artwork, correspondence, and personal testimonies that reflect the St. Louis community’s experiences surrounding the October 7 terrorist attacks in Israel and their aftermath. On October 7, 2026, you may bring your items to St. Louis Kaplan Feldman Holocaust Museum between 10am and 3pm to speak with a representative of our Collections staff about a potential donation.

The commemoration will include the reading of the names of October 7 victims from 4:00–6:30 p.m. and will conclude with the St. Louis premiere public screening of the documentary The Bridge from 7:00–9:00 p.m.
Registration is required for the film screening. We strongly encourage all community members to register in advance for The Bridge and reserve their spot for this powerful evening of reflection, remembrance, and connection.
